Known for its significance during the Civil War, Manassas is located about 30 miles southwest of Washington, D.C. Manassas honors its historical past with an extensive museum system and weekly walking tours while maintaining a modern vibe with access to major shopping centers, parks, and cultural amenities.
Renting in Manassas affords you the opportunity to learn more about the Civil War at Manassas National Battlefield Park, watch an opera at Hylton Performing Arts Center, enjoy the variety of retailers at Manassas Mall, taste the offerings at Paradise Springs Winery, make waves at Splash Down Waterpark, and reach new heights at Vertical Rock Indoor Climbing Center.
Getting around from Manassas is easy with convenience to I-66 and Manassas Regional Airport in addition to the Manassas Train Station, which is serviced by both Amtrak and VRE Commuter Trains.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
